
Paperback
Published 28 Aug 2019
10 results
Paperback
Published 28 Aug 2019
Paperback
Published 28 Aug 2019
Paperback
Published 28 Aug 2019
Paperback
Published 28 Aug 2019
Paperback
Published 29 Aug 2019
Paperback
Published 28 Aug 2019
Paperback
Published 28 Aug 2019
Paperback
Published 28 Aug 2019
Paperback
Published 28 Aug 2019
Paperback
Published 28 Aug 2019